CaliforniaCenterforSustainableCommunitiesatUCLACaliforniaCenterforSustainableCommunitiesatUCLA
• Percapitagroundwaterrightsvarywidelythroughouttheregion– Forinstance,theCityofSantaFeSpringshas~220gallons/person/day(gpd),whilethe
CityofArtesiahaslessthan2gpd– Acrossthecounty,UpperBasinuserstendtohavemorepercapitapumpingrights
• Themajorityofcitieswithrights(28)haverightsoflessthan100gpd– Twelvecitieshaverightslessthan22gpd.– Manycitiesintheregionwouldnotmeetevenconservativeestimatesofpercapitadaily
waterusewithcurrentgroundwaterrights
• Nearlyone-thirdofcitieshavenogroundwaterrightsandnodirectaccesstogroundwaterforwatersupply.
– WatermanagersthroughoutL.A.increasinglylooktousedistributedstormwaterinfrastructuretoimprovewaterqualityandrechargegroundwaterbasins
– Citiesmustpayforstormwaterinfrastructureupgrades,butiftheyhavenopumpingrights,theycannotuseprojectedwatersupplyrevenuestopayfornewstormwatersystems.

CaliforniaCenterforSustainableCommunitiesatUCLA
Findings
• Managementsystemishighlyfragmentedacrosstheregionandstilldividedbyurbanwatersectors(groundwater,stormwater,watersupply)
• Despitechallenges,thecomplexandpolycentricsystemofgroundwatermanagementhasmanagedtoadaptovertime
– Actorsofvaryingsizesandorganizationalstructuresnegotiatetransactionsandwatertransfers,movingwaterfromareasofgreaterabundancetoareasofscarcity
– Buttheseareshorttermadaptations,notlongtermchangesforclimatechange
– Limitedinscopeaswell:landscapingneedstoevolve,infiltration,stormwatercaptureandwaterrecyclingneedsubstantial interandtransjurisdictionalinstitutionalreform
• Adaptivecapacityisconstrainedbyestablishedallocationsofrights,limitedcost-effectivestorage,diverseinstitutionalknowledge,anddecreasinglyavailableimportedwater

PolicyRecommendations
Reducerelianceonimportedwater
Watermastersmustplanfor long-termreductionsinavailableimportedwaterforrecharge.Managementmustfocus onreducingwaterdemands andreplenishment ofbasins fromcapturedlocalstormwater.
Identifycapacityforwaterreuse
Waterreusecanreduceimports, butitrequiresassessments availablegroundwaterbasincapacity,wherewatercanbestored,aswellasnewinfrastructureforpiping.Newregulationsenablingcollectivestoragepools ingroundwaterbasins canallowagenciestodevelop collectivereuseprojects.
Reallocategroundwaterrights
Codified groundwater rightsinhibitsystemflexibility andadaptabilitytomeetfuturescarcitychallenges.Moreequitableaccesstogroundwaterwillhelpgreaterwaterselfreliancebutwillrequirereallocatingsomeextractionrights asagenciesstoremorewateringroundwaterbasinstomeetwatershortagesduringdroughts.
Regulategroundwaterforthiscentury
L.A. County’s diversegroundwatermanagementsystemmirrorsstatewidefragmentationandlocalcontrol.Stateandregionalagenciesmustmanageacrossdiverseclimatesandcultures.Newsustainable groundwatermanagementregulationsshould buildontheknowledgeofL.A.approachesbut,unlike L.A.,reduceinstitutionalized relianceonimportedwater.
